Is Innventure, Inc. (INVLW) a Good Investment?
Innventure is a blank-check company in severe financial distress with massive operating losses (-$433M), negative net income (-$255.6M), and critically weak liquidity (0.39x current ratio). The company is burning cash at an alarming rate (-$57.7M free cash flow) with minimal revenue generation ($1.2M) and only $9.1M in cash reserves, creating an imminent solvency risk.
Innventure’s fundamentals are extremely weak: revenue is negligible relative to its cost base, operating losses are massive, and cash flow is deeply negative. Liquidity is strained with a sub-1.0 current ratio and limited cash on hand, which raises material concerns about funding needs and the quality and durability of any future growth.

INVLW Stock Risks: Innventure, Inc. Investment Risks
- Critically low liquidity with current ratio of 0.39x and only $9.1M cash against massive operating losses
- Catastrophic profitability metrics with -35,087% operating margin and -20,710% net margin indicating fundamental business failure
- Severe cash burn of $57.7M negative free cash flow with current cash reserves insufficient to sustain operations beyond months
- Blank-check company status with minimal revenue generation and massive accumulated losses indicating failed merger/acquisition integration
- Operating margin and net margin are catastrophically negative, indicating an unsustainable earnings profile
- Current ratio of 0.39x and cash of only $9.06M point to near-term liquidity pressure
- Operating cash flow and free cash flow are sharply negative, increasing the likelihood of dilution or external financing needs
